Motorcyclists face distinct dangers because they __________. A. Are hard to see B. Are not entitled to use a full lane C. Do not
Ne4ueva [31]

Answer:

A. Are hard to see

Explanation:

Motorcyclists have the same responsibilities and rights as car and truck drivers. The same rules apply to all of them (the motorcyclists are also entitled to a full lane), but an important difference is the lack of visibility in the motorcyclists' case. To decrease the issue, many motorcycles have headlights that automatically turn on when the vehicle starts moving.

Measures of precaution are expected from the car and truck drivers, too. For example, they shouldn't only check their mirrors, but do a visual check as well, as motorcycles can easily end up in the blind spot of the vehicle. The drivers should dim their headlights while approaching a motorcycle as, for them, the blinding effect is greater.

Which is the primary factor taken into consideration during distribution of grants and loans among eligible students?
balu736 [363]

Answer: the primary factor taken into consideration during distribution of grants and loans among eligible students is financial needs

Explanation: It is the need-based aid. When the panel is considering to approve the loan, they calculate the student’s need by subtracting their expected family contribution from the cost of education from the budget assigned. A student should have an adequate amount of need in order to accommodate the aid, and for this, they take into account the students financial needs
